About BSRIA:
BSRIA is a science-driven, independent organisation providing practical guidance and commercial solutions for the built environment. With 70 years of expertise, BSRIA delivers impactful insights through market intelligence, consultancy, testing, compliance, research, training, and instrumentation. Committed to shaping the future of the built environment, BSRIA collaborates with industry leaders to drive innovation, sustainability, and efficiency. Its UKAS-accredited test facilities and expert consultants equip businesses and consumers with the insights and tools needed to create better buildings. Headquartered in Bracknell, UK, with offices in China and the USA, BSRIA supports a global network of organisations and corporations in the built environment.
About The Role:
This Product Engineer role is an excellent opportunity to build a career in precision measurement and calibration. You will play a vital role in ensuring equipment accuracy, reliability, and compliance, while gaining hands-on experience across the full calibration lifecycle for a wide range of measurement parameters. You will be responsible for setting up and operating calibration equipment, performing measurements, analysing results, and supporting wider instrumentation sales and hire operations. The role involves using data analysis, documentation, and working to industry standards such as ISO/IEC 17025.
